¿Cómo puedo formatear mi tarjeta SD para usarla normalmente de nuevo?

122

Deseo volver a formatear mi tarjeta SD para volver a usarla normalmente (actualmente tiene una partición FAT32 de 78 MB y una partición Linux de 3.9 GB). ¿Cómo hago esto (en Windows / Mac / * nix)?

Tom Medley
fuente
2
Esto puede sonar muy divertido, pero si tiene un microsd que Linux no lee pero se muestra usando fdisk, colóquelo en su teléfono Android, vaya a configuración> Almacenamiento> Almacenamiento extraíble> Formato. Eso es. Puede usarlo como un dispositivo de almacenamiento normal a partir de entonces. Simplemente lo hice después de hacer todo el yada yada durante 1-2 horas
freerunner
no estoy seguro si hay inconvenientes en la sugerencia de @freerunner, pero seguramente es fácil y funcionó bien para mí.
Triamus

Respuestas:

173

Puede usar DISKPARTen Windows, o el fdiskcomando equivalente en Linux / Mac.


DISKPART (Windows)

Inicie un símbolo del sistema e inicie la consola DISKPART. Enumere todos sus discos escribiendo LIST DISK, luego seleccione el disco apropiado con SELECT DISK #(donde # es la tarjeta SD). Luego puede escribir CLEANpara borrar la tabla de particiones en la tarjeta, de manera efectiva. ¡ASEGÚRESE DE QUE SELECCIONÓ EL DISCO ADECUADO ANTES DE EJECUTAR EL CLEANMANDO!

Para crear una partición primaria para reutilizar el espacio en la tarjeta, escriba CREATE PARTITION PRIMARY. Esto reasignará el espacio previamente "limpiado".

Para formatear, escribir FORMAT FS=FAT32 QUICKy, finalmente, para reasignar una letra de unidad, escriba ASSIGN.

Si usted es incapaz de determinar el disco adecuado, retire la tarjeta SD, ejecutar DISKPARTy LIST DISK, a continuación, volver a ejecutarlo con la tarjeta SD insertada. La tarjeta SD es solo el disco que se ha agregado.

Tenga en cuenta que los comandos anteriores no distinguen entre mayúsculas y minúsculas; Usé mayúsculas para hacer coincidir las DISKPARTpantallas de la convención .


FDISK/ CFDISK(Linux / Mac)

En una terminal, comience fdisk /dev/sdxdonde /dev/sdxestá su dispositivo de tarjeta SD (puede depender de la distribución de Linux que esté utilizando, ver más abajo). Luego puede eliminar todas las particiones existentes en el dispositivo escribiendo d, y luego agregando una única partición nueva y formateándola. También puede escribir n para crear una nueva tabla de particiones y comenzar a diseñar todo.

cfdiskTambién es otra herramienta viable, que es básicamente fdiskcon una interfaz de usuario muy mejorada. En ambos casos, una vez que se formatea la unidad, finalmente la necesitará mount.

Si no puede determinar el dispositivo adecuado, retire la tarjeta SD, ejecútela fdisk -ly vuelva a ejecutarla con la tarjeta SD insertada. La tarjeta SD es solo el dispositivo que se ha agregado.

Gran descubrimiento o desarrollo, progreso, ruptura, penetracion
fuente
@AlexChamberlain en DISKPART, generalmente se puede decir por la capacidad del disco. Una vez que seleccione un disco, también puede llamar LIST VOLUMEpara ver todos los volúmenes de las unidades y sus etiquetas (siempre que aparezca el nombre de su tarjeta SD, tiene el dispositivo correcto). Si está utilizando fdisk, escriba p para imprimir la tabla de particiones y verifique que las etiquetas de volumen sean correctas. Si está utilizando cfdisk, debería mostrarle las etiquetas de volumen justo después de iniciar el comando en un dispositivo.
Avance el
Tengo una tarjeta SD de 64 GB. Diskpart me dice que es demasiado grande para formatearlo en fat32. ¿Hay alguna opción para hacerlo de todos modos? ¿O tengo que usar software de terceros?
CGFoX
17

En tu cámara

La mayoría de las cámaras tienen una función de formato incorporada, que utilizará una sola partición FAT. Mi cámara incluso lo pone en un límite de bloque de borrado.

Por ejemplo, en mi Pansonic Lumix, después de haber insertado la tarjeta y desde cualquier modo, el menú como una entrada de Formato . Al seleccionarlo, aparece un menú que me pide que confirme que deseo eliminar todos los datos de la tarjeta. Al seleccionar Sí, se formatea la tarjeta.

Alex Chamberlain
fuente
1
:) Será una partición FAT, comenzando en el segundo bloque de borrado.
Alex Chamberlain el
3
Tendrá formato FAT como cualquier otro dispositivo con formato FAT ... no es específico de la cámara. Sin embargo, tendrá que eliminar varias carpetas creadas como "DCIM"
Alexander
Evité esta respuesta ya que sonaba como una mala forma de hacerlo, pero nada más aquí funcionó y esto funcionó de maravilla. Eliminé todas las particiones, abrí la tarjeta SD en la cámara, formateé y ahora tengo mis 30 GB disponibles en lugar del 1.4 que se muestra.
Dean Meehan
16

Puede usar la aplicación oficial SDCard.org (Windows / Mac):

Es bastante simple y reformatea la tarjeta SD en FAT32. También hay opciones para el ajuste de LBA y el borrado / borrado.

Sam Dunlap
fuente
Al momento de escribir, este software ni siquiera se ejecuta en Windows 10. ¡Sin errores, solo bombardea inmediatamente con un número de error en blanco en el registro de eventos!
Grim
9

Actualmente, parece que no se ha mencionado una de las mejores utilidades de administración de discos : GParted :
foto de GParted

Esto se incluye en muchas distribuciones de Linux y, de lo contrario, se puede instalar fácilmente. Para otros sistemas, es posible ejecutarlo desde un DVD o una memoria USB, por lo que también se puede usar allí. La parte de Linux también significa que es compatible con el formato de tarjeta SD si es ext*así, por lo que puede formatearse de manera fácil y eficiente, y es probable que ocurran menos problemas. La mayoría de las utilidades de disco, en particular en Windows, probablemente destruyan cualquier dato de arranque en la tarjeta SD y la acumulen de otras maneras.

Aquí una captura de pantalla de GParted que muestra el contenido de una tarjeta SD con Raspbian encendido:
captura de pantalla de GParted
Nota: La partición de arranque probablemente tendrá una etiqueta o bandera 'boot'

Para realizar operaciones en una partición de un, haga clic derecho sobre él y seleccione 'Desmontar'. Si se monta una partición (que se muestra mediante un conjunto de claves junto al nombre de la partición), no se pueden realizar operaciones en ella. Una vez que se desmonta, puede verificar si hay errores, volver a formatearlo, cambiarle el nombre, eliminarlo y crear uno nuevo, etc.

La documentación sobre el uso de GParted se puede encontrar aquí

Wilf
fuente
5

Hay algunas herramientas específicas solo para tarjetas SD, pero me gusta usar EaseUS Partition Tool, que es gratis para los usuarios de Windows. No funcionará en las ediciones de servidor. * Tenga en cuenta que aparentemente están empaquetando algún software. Haga clic en las opciones avanzadas para evitar esto .

Debe tener cuidado al seleccionar su tarjeta SD de la lista de dispositivos, ya que esta herramienta enumerará todas sus unidades. Esto muestra cómo cambiar el tamaño de una partición.

Ingrese la descripción de la imagen aquí

  • La mejor apuesta es completar eliminar cualquier partición en la tarjeta SD. Esto incluirá FAT y ext y posiblemente un SWAP. Simplemente elimínelos para que pueda ver 16 GB completos sin asignar.
  • No se realizarán operaciones hasta que haga clic en APLICAR. Una vez que haya eliminado todas las particiones, siga las instrucciones para volver a cargar la distribución que desee.

Error de hardware

Sin embargo, si en la lista ve que su tarjeta aparece como 55 MB de tamaño total y no tiene la opción de eliminarla o expandirla más, eso significa que la tarjeta SD puede estar rota.

Puede usar una herramienta llamada Formateador de tarjeta de memoria SD : vaya a esa página, lea los términos, desplácese hacia abajo y acepte si está de acuerdo. Este software solo formateará dispositivos externos. Como tarjeta SD o dispositivo USB.

Seleccione opciones AJUSTE RÁPIDO y DE FORMATO: ¡ACTIVADO!

ingrese la descripción de la imagen aquí

Eso debería restablecer toda la tarjeta SD a su tamaño original. Si se produce un error en este punto, es más probable que la tarjeta esté completamente dañada.

Como último recurso, puede intentar formatear la tarjeta en una cámara dSLR o teléfono móvil que acepte la tarjeta.

Ejemplo

Esta es mi tarjeta SD Raspbian de 4 GB. Usé herramientas de administración de Windows. Sí, lo muestra, pero no le permitirá hacer nada en las particiones por si acaso ... lo elimina o Windows corrompe algo (porque no es compatible con ese sistema de archivos).

Ingrese la descripción de la imagen aquí

El maestro de partición EaseUS muestra una lista mucho mejor y comprende los sistemas de archivos utilizados. Haga clic derecho y elimine las particiones. También puede crear nuevas particiones y aplicar todo, y tendrá toda la tarjeta SD de nuevo para usar en Windows o si desea grabar otra imagen en la tarjeta.

Ingrese la descripción de la imagen aquí

Aquí he eliminado las particiones. Haga clic derecho y dijo "Crear nueva partición". Hay una lista completa de tipos de sistemas de archivos. No hice clic en aplicar, por lo que aún no se ha realizado ninguna operación.

Ingrese la descripción de la imagen aquí

Piotr Kula
fuente
2
Este programa intenta instalar una serie de otras aplicaciones cuando lo instala.
PhillyNJ
Lo siento cuando escribí esto que no fue un problema. He actualizado mi respuesta para advertir sobre esto. Todavía siento que es un buen software y espero que se elimine el voto negativo.
Piotr Kula
Hecho, pero no lo instalaría. Mi software antivirus estaba bloqueando la instalación de un montón de cosas.
PhillyNJ
Puede ser un poco exagerado para una tarea tan simple, pero funciona.
Ivotje50
1
Mi tarjeta tenía 60 MB de tamaño, como escribiste en "Error de hardware", pero en lugar de tirarla, la formateé con mi teléfono móvil y ya no tiene 16 GB :)
greuze
4

Algo notable al usar la herramienta oficial de formateador SD. (Esto realmente debería ser un comentario, pero aparentemente no puedo agregar una captura de pantalla a un comentario).

Esto me hizo tropezar por un día más o menos. Ejecuté el SD Formatter pensando que repararía mi tarjeta SD. Observé que la unidad J: el tamaño era de solo 60Mb. Es una tarjeta de 16 Gb. Pensé que (según la herramienta de formato que he estado usando durante los últimos 30 años) solo formatearía la partición de 60Mb.

ERROR. En realidad, reparte el dispositivo en una sola partición de tamaño completo y luego lo formatea (en este caso a sus 16 Gb completos; consulte la ventana de primer plano en comparación con la ventana de fondo). ESTA Esta es la herramienta que necesitas. Manos abajo. ¡¡no se hicieron preguntas!!

KDM
fuente
+1 para el problema de 60MB que tengo, eso finalmente no es un problema 60MB => 16GB al final si la tarjeta es de 16GB :)
Basj
-2

Tuve un problema muy similar. Mi configuración: computadora con Windows 7 y Sandisk ultra card 16 GB.

Quería formatear mi tarjeta para instalar OpenELEC . Así que descargué el formateador SD e intenté formatearlo. ¡Se convirtió en una tarjeta de 64 MB! Probé varias configuraciones, probé diskpart en CMD y formato limpio usando la consola de administración de computadora / administración de disco, sin suerte. El escritor winimg siempre afirmó que no había suficiente espacio en la tarjeta. Anteriormente (es decir, antes de usar el formateador SD) expandirá el espacio y se instalará, y posteriormente utilicé el comando expandir en el terminal Raspberry Pi. Entonces, esto es lo que hice:

Descargué BerryBoot (¡tenga en cuenta que son 28 MB!), Escribí la imagen en la tarjeta SD y arranqué la Raspberry Pi. BerryBoot volvió a formatear el mismo utilizando su propio programa integrado. Ahora saqué la tarjeta y la formateé usando la herramienta de formato en Windows con FAT. Saqué la tarjeta y la reinserté. ¡Ahora lee 14.4 GB! Cualquiera atascado así puede probar esto.

subbu567
fuente
44
Windows solo verá la pequeña partición de encabezado que queda cuando la tarjeta está formateada para compatibilidad con Linux. Entonces, la tarjeta sigue siendo del mismo tamaño, es solo que Windows no puede entender la partición de Linux e ignora por completo su existencia. Al igual que Linux hace con esa partición de encabezado.
Phill Healey el
-4

No es bueno en Mac con el último OS X. La tarjeta no se puede borrar de ninguna manera.

Merv
fuente
1
Tonterías, ¿qué pasa fdisk?
Jivings
@Jivings ya que no puedo editar (debido a mi juerga de preguntas frecuentes), ¿cómo debo responder a esta pregunta mientras reviso: bandera, comentario, etc.?
xxmbabanexx
@xxmbabanexx Downvote probablemente. Que es una respuesta, es simplemente incorrecto. Y eso no es un delito que se pueda señalar.
Jivings